Ange Postecoglou, the Celtics hero, has received praise from Rio Ferdinand for his recent interactions with an English media.

Celtic supporters had the good fortune to watch the now-Tottenham Hotspur manager accomplish a domestic triple crown in one of the most impressive and engaging ways in the team’s history the previous season.

In both on-field style of play and off-field media interactions, Ange Postecoglou is bringing a breath of fresh air to the Premier League. Despite a reporter disrespectfully questioning his trophy-winning capabilities with the query, “Do you picture yourself winning trophies?”, Postecoglou responded assertively, stating, “I’ve got real pictures, mate. There are quite a few of them, mate. I just look at the ones I have got. I’ve earned them, it’s not luck.”

Former Manchester United star Rio Ferdinand appreciated Postecoglou’s response, describing it as him telling the reporter to ‘sit back in your seat.’ The incident highlighted the ignorance of the English press but also showcased Postecoglou’s achievements not only at Celtic but also in Japan.

Life after Celtic for Ange Postecoglou

Given the glitz, glamour and money on show in the Premier League, many are just now starting to witness the magic of Postecoglou.

It could be argued that Spurs are playing the best football in the Premier League and the former Hoops man’s highly-demanding nature is playing a big part in that all.

At Parkhead, after taking over when Rangers won the league, the Australian took time to settle in before seriously motoring forward.

But at Spurs, he started like a house on fire. Picking up the most points from a new manager after ten games, sitting top of the league and now still sitting in a healthy position in fifth despite suffering big injuries across the pitch.
